The truth is, databases are where the real danger hides. They hold production secrets, private user info, and the logs your models feed on. Traditional access layers see the connection but not the intent. That means even well-meaning automations can expose PII, duplicate systems, or deploy schema changes that break everything upstream. And come audit time, no one remembers exactly what happened.
That’s where modern Database Governance and Observability come in. Think of it as a guardrail system for every query, command, and AI-driven action. Instead of trusting static credentials or blind tunnels, every connection is verified through identity, context, and intent. Queries are logged in real time, updates recorded with full lineage, and admin changes linked directly to a known user or agent.
With strong observability, you spot drift before it becomes outage. With governance, you prove control instead of promising it.
